Just like your co-op, the farmer-funded dairy checkoff is in the business of selling and promoting consumption of your milk. No longer known for generic advertising and short-term retail promotions, today’s checkoff works with and through co-ops, brands, partners and the industry, including Land O’Lakes, to find a home, here and around the world, for increasing milk production. Here’s how:
• The checkoff worked with pizza companies and suppliers on product reinvention and marketing to create a dramatic turnaround in pizza and the amount of cheese sold through pizza. We have taken a category that represents 25 percent of all cheese sales and was on a steep, multiple-year decline, and turned it around to generate 24 straight months of unparalleled growth – using an additional 2 billion pounds of milk per year in this effort. One outgrowth of that was the conversion of cheese purchases by the big three pizza chains for their Pacific Rim/Asia outlets from foreign to U.S. sources, resulting in 60 million new pounds of cheese sourced here at home this year.
• Today, dairy-based specialty beverage options such as coffee-flavored dairy drinks, smoothies and many other products at fast food restaurants are growing. We started that change with McDonald’s, and others followed.
